What this network stands for
The Réseaux IP Européens Network Coordination Centre is a Regional Internet Registry. The RIPE NCC coordinates the allocation and registration of Internet number resources for Europe, the Middle East and parts of Central Asia.
These resources include IP address ranges and autonomous system numbers. For companies, comprehensible address planning, the documentation of responsibilities and suitable routing concepts are important building blocks of a reliable network architecture.

What is a Regional Internet Registry?
A RIR coordinates the management and registration of Internet number resources in a specific region of the world. The RIPE NCC is responsible for Europe, the Middle East and parts of Central Asia.
What is the difference between RIPE and RIPE NCC?
RIPE is an open community for the technical and administrative coordination of IP networks. The RIPE NCC is the organization that supports this work as a Regional Internet Registry and with other services. This page describes the RIPE-NCC membership.
What is an AS number needed for?
An Autonomous System Number identifies an autonomous system when exchanging routing information. Whether a separate AS number is necessary and suitable must be assessed on the basis of the network and operating concept.
